How they compare

Uganda currently reports 0.1109 Mt CO2e against 0.1014 Mt CO2e in Zambia, a difference of 0.0095 Mt CO2e.

That makes Uganda's figure about 1.1 times Zambia's.

The two have swapped places 5 times across 55 shared years of data; in 1970 it was Zambia ahead.

Uganda ranks 12th and Zambia ranks 14th of 187 countries.

Across the 6 decades both report, Uganda averaged higher in 3 and Zambia in 3.

Head to head by decade

Decade Uganda Zambia Difference Ahead
1970s 0.0153 Mt CO2e 0.0153 Mt CO2e 0 Mt CO2e Zambia
1980s 0.0206 Mt CO2e 0.0193 Mt CO2e 0.0014 Mt CO2e Uganda
1990s 0.0251 Mt CO2e 0.0247 Mt CO2e 0.0003 Mt CO2e Uganda
2000s 0.032 Mt CO2e 0.0346 Mt CO2e 0.0027 Mt CO2e Zambia
2010s 0.0564 Mt CO2e 0.0624 Mt CO2e 0.006 Mt CO2e Zambia
2020s 0.1049 Mt CO2e 0.0969 Mt CO2e 0.0081 Mt CO2e Uganda

Averages of every year both report within each decade.

A measure of annual emissions of nitrous oxide (N2O), one of the six Kyoto greenhouse gases (GHG), from fugitive emissions (subsector of the energy sector) including IPCC 2006 codes 1.A.1.bc Petroleum Refining - Manufacture of Solid Fuels and Other Energy Industries, 1.B.1 Solid Fuels, 1.B.2 Oil and Natural Gas, 5.B.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
